Checkm8 is a permanent bootrom exploit for Apple devices with A5 through A11 chips. It's "permanent" because it exists in read-only memory (ROM), meaning Apple cannot patch it with a software update. It's the foundation upon which ipwnder_lite and many other jailbreak tools are built.

is a specialized utility tool designed for iOS enthusiasts and technicians to put vulnerable Apple devices into Pwned DFU (Device Firmware Update) mode directly from a PC. Traditionally, exploiting the hardware-level bootrom vulnerability (checkm8) required a macOS or Linux environment. iPwnder v11 bridges this gap, giving Windows users the ability to prep their iPhones and iPads for iCloud bypasses, custom firmware flashing, and deep system modifications.
